Yesterday, June 14, BJ Novack hosted the 14th Annual 'Webby Awards' at Cipriani, Wall Street in New York City. The 'Webby Awards' is the leading international award honoring excellence on the Internet. The Webbys were established in 1996 during the Web's infancy. The Webbys are presented by The International Academy of Digital Arts and Sciences, which includes a 750-member body of leading web experts, business figures, luminaries, visionaries and creative celebrities, and associate members who are former 'Webby Award' winners and nominees and other internet professionals.
